Is Traditional Leadership Development Enough to Combat Rising Workplace Stress?
The latest State of the Global Workplace: 2024 Report reveals some alarming statistics:
41% of employees are experiencing significant levels of stress. Employees in poorly managed environments are 60% more likely to experience high stress compared to those in well-managed workplaces. 30% more employees under bad management report high stress compared to the unemployed.
Workplace stress is escalating at a rapid rate, and traditional solutions are falling short.
💭 So what if we approached the development of our managers differently?
Instead of focusing solely on management techniques and strategies, what if we prioritized the holistic growth of our leaders?
